Search, Paging, and "As of" Date (#10)

Issues Fixed:
* Added request search capability (#2)
* Added pagination to search / inactive request lists (#3)
* Added "as of" date display option for requests (#9)
* Updated documentation to reflect the new options and their behavior

Also Fixed (w/o issue numbers):
* Fixed a verbiage error with the confirmation prompts
* Split the I18N for the maintain requests page into its own localized view
* Modified many "magic strings" in the code to use F# discriminated unions instead (stored as single-character codes in the database)
